1037562
0x2ffbc967652bc514f041417f443db9c68886e517346eab8fe0412a1dad36f8d2
Transactions0
Height1037562
Confirmations13709812
Timestamp1148 days 2 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x1031181793ce6d18
Bits
Difficulty0x48aacf3